WebIncluding The word “including” or any variation thereof means “including, without limitation” and shall not be construed to limit any general statement that it follows to the specific or … WebOct 17, 2016 · The recommended punctuation for ultimate clarity would therefore be the following: “There are many activities including, but not limited to, running, jumping, and swimming.”. The comma placed between “jumping” and “and swimming” is an example of an Oxford comma. It could be excluded as well, resulting in the following: “There are ...

WebTranslations in context of "includes, but is not limited to, information" in English-Romanian from Reverso Context: The information referred to in this subparagraph includes, but is not limited to, information about actions of the group and supervisors, and information provided by … c and l welding farmvilleWebSep 2, 2015 · Doesn’t including itself imply but not limited to? The answer is yes, of course. But legal drafting isn’t served well by implications, as opposed to explicit denotations.
